We did a 6 hour flight to Majuro in the Marshall islands then island hopped the rest of the way to Chuuk. It's amazing how you can just get on a plane and then end up in a completely different world and culture in just a few hours! Then we flew to Kwajalein, which is now owned by the U.S. military. It's kind of a sad story actually, they kicked everyone off the island and now most of them live on Ebeye, a much smaller neighboring island. There are about 10,000 people there.. Anyway, we couldn't get off there cause it was a base. After we flew to Kosrae which is the only state made up of only one island and there are only 5 villages on it. It is particularly beautiful there. They sell huge amounts of tangerines at the airport which are so sweet and delicious! I want to go back someday. Lots of tourists go to FSM for great snorkeling and diving (I HAVE to get my diver's license). Then we went to Pohnpei and finally Chuuk. There are distinctly different vibes on every island. There is only one main road here FILLED with pot holes and lots of stray dogs and pigs. Betelnut is not as huge here as it is in Samoa, but common. They cut the nut in half, fill it with lime (not the fruit, but lime lime) and tobacco from a cigarette then wrap it all in a green leaf of some sort and chew it. They spit red and apparently it gives them a buzz and is pretty addictive, but it makes their teeth red and rotten. You can tell if someone is a betelnut chewer.
